摘 要:评价黑河中游水资源承载力对促进该区域水资源的高效利用并推动经济可持续发展具有重要意义。为此,选取10个主要评价指标,并采用模糊综合评判模型定量分析了黑河中游2000~2020年水资源承载力动态变化状况。结果表明,黑河中游水资源承载力综合评分值在0.3~0.5之间,其中最高值出现在2020年,达到0.471,整体水资源承载力处于中级阶段,即可承载状态。黑河中游应调整用水结构,加强发展节水型经济和生态环境保护,以提高水资源的合理高效利用。The evaluation of carrying capacity of water resources in the middle reaches of the Heihe River is important to promote the efficient use of water resources and sustainable economic development of the region. This paper quantitatively analyzed the dynamic changes of the water resources carrying capacity of the middle reaches of the Heihe River from 2000 to 2020 by selecting 10 evaluation indexes and using the fuzzy comprehensive evaluation model. The results show that the water resources carrying capacity of the region is between 0.3 and 0.5, with the highest value reaching 0.471 in 2020, and the water resources carrying capacities are in a bearable state. In order to improve the rational and efficient use of water resources, the middle reaches of the Heihe River should adjust the water use structure and strengthen the development of water-saving economy and ecological environmental protection.
